Suzlon Energy Limited has appointed Ms. Manjari Upadhye as President – Renewable Energy (RE) Asset Management Services (AMS), effective September 4, 2026. The appointment has been made in accordance with the disclosure requirements under Regulation 30 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015.
As part of her new role, Upadhye will serve as a Senior Managerial Personnel (SMP) and will report directly to the Group Chief Executive Officer of Suzlon Energy Limited. She has joined the company as a full-time employee and will be responsible for driving the company’s renewable energy asset management services business.
Upadhye brings 27 years of end-to-end P&L leadership experience across India, the United States and the Asia-Pacific region. Before joining Suzlon Energy, she was associated with the Auto Division of Mahindra & Mahindra. Her earlier professional experience includes leadership roles at Welspun, Amazon.com, Danone, Mondelez (Cadbury), PepsiCo and Colgate-Palmolive, including positions as CEO.
She holds an MBA in Marketing and Finance from the Faculty of Management Studies (FMS), Delhi. Her expertise spans consumer behaviour, services management, brand building, distribution expansion and margin-accretive growth, with experience across businesses ranging from startups to organizations with revenues of up to $10 billion.
Suzlon Energy stated that Upadhye’s appointment strengthens its senior leadership team as the company continues to develop its renewable energy asset management capabilities. The company also confirmed that she has no relationship with any of the directors on its Board.
The regulatory intimation was signed by Geetanjali S. Vaidya, Company Secretary of Suzlon Energy Limited, and submitted to the National Stock Exchange of India Limited and BSE Limited on September 4, 2026.
